There are 'no plans' to send troops to midterm polling sites, top general says
Joint Chiefs of Staff Chairman Gen. Dan Caine says there are no plans to send troops to polling places in the November midterm election, nor has he received such an order, in response to concerns from Democrats that President Donald Trump could use the military to interfere in the election.
